COLUMBUS – Mary Elizabeth Jones, 96, of Columbus, passed away on Thursday, Aug. 12, 2021, at the Kobacker House in Columbus. She was born on July 31, 1925, in Winchester, to the late Edwin and Mattie (Knechtly) Whisner.
Mary was a loving m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, great-great grandmother, and spouse of her late husband of seventy years, Gene. Mary attended Russelville High School, Capital University, where she received an Associate’s degree in business and The Ohio State University where she received her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ration. She was a full-time mother, part-time secretary who loved gardening, golfing, sewing and cooking. One of her many talents was cake decorating. She made several beautiful wedding cakes and taught cake decorating classes.
